Creating an Amazon Account:

The first step to accessing Amazon’s extensive marketplace is creating an account. Visit the Amazon homepage and click on the “Account & Lists” tab. From there, choose the “Create your Amazon account” option. Provide the necessary information, including your name, email address, and a secure password. Amazon may require additional details for verification purposes. Once completed, your Amazon account is ready for use.

Managing Your Account Information:

After creating an account, it’s crucial to keep your information updated. Access the “Account & Lists” section and select “Your Account.” Here, you can edit personal details, add or change payment methods, and update shipping addresses. Regularly reviewing and updating this information ensures a smooth and hassle-free shopping experience.

Understanding Amazon Prime:

Amazon Prime is a subscription service offering various benefits, including free and expedited shipping, access to streaming services, and exclusive deals. To sign up for Amazon Prime, go to the “Account & Lists” section and select “Your Prime Membership.” Choose a plan that suits your needs, and enjoy the perks of a Prime membership.

Securing Your Amazon Account:

Security is paramount when it comes to online accounts. Amazon provides several tools to enhance the security of your account. Enable two-step verification for an extra layer of protection. Regularly monitor your account activity by reviewing recent orders and ensuring they align with your purchases. If you ever suspect unauthorized access, change your password immediately and contact Amazon’s customer support.

Handling Returns and Refunds:

Amazon has a customer-friendly return and refund policy. To initiate a return, go to the “Your Orders” section, select the item you want to return, and follow the prompts. Amazon also provides guidelines for returning products, ensuring a straightforward process.
